Tennis is a sport typically played between two people in a singles match, or between two teams of two people each in a doubles match. Tennis is an outdoor activity played on a court, usually during warm weather months. The game can be played on grass, clay, or hard courts.

The Number of Tennis Players by Skill Level

Based on data from the Tennis Industry Association, there are a estimated 16.9 million people who play tennis in the United States. Of those, 4.5 million are what the industry calls “core Tennis Players,” meaning they play eight or more times per year on a court, with a racket. The remaining 12.4 million people are considered “occasional” players, playing three or fewer times per year.
